Jeremiah 22:26
And I will cast thee out, and thy mother that bare thee, into another country, where ye were not born; and there shall ye die.

Jeremiah 22:26 in other translations
American Standard Version
And I will cast thee out, and thy mother that bare thee, into another country, where ye were not born; and there shall ye die.
World English Bible
I will cast you out, and your mother who bore you, into another country, where you were not born; and there you will die.
Douay-Rheims
And I will send thee, and thy mother that bore thee, into a strange country, in which you were not born, and there you shall die:
Geneva Bible (1599)
And I will cause them to cary thee away, and thy mother that bare thee, into another countrey, where ye were not borne, and there shall ye die.
